The purpose of this design manual is to provide an introduction to stirling cycle heat engines, to organize and identify the available stirling engine literature, and to identify, organize, evaluate and, in so far as possible, compare nonproprietary stirling engine design methodologies. For stirling engines to enjoy widespread application and acceptance, not only must the fundamental operation of such engines be widely understood, but the requisite analytic tools for the stimulation, design, evaluation and optimization of stirling engine hardware must be readily available. Stirling engines are an external combustion heat engine that converts thermal energy into mechanical work that a closed cycle is run by cyclic compression and expansion of a work fluid commonly air or helium in which, the working fluid interacts with a heat source and a heat sink and produces network. The stirling engine, invented in 1816, running according to a reversible closed cycle knew a practical use as a reliable and sure engine, during almost one century before being supplanted by the sparkignition engine.
